Suchergebnisse für Anfrage "go"
Wie schreibe ich einen Proxy in Go (Golang) mit TCP-Verbindungen
Ich entschuldige mich vorab, wenn einige dieser Fragen für erfahrene Netzwerkprogrammierer offensichtlich sein könnten. Ich habe über das Codieren im Netzwerk recherchiert und gelesen und es ist mir immer noch nicht klar, wie ich das machen ...
Variable Anzahl der Rückgabevariablen in Funktion in Go
Ich frage mich, ob es eine Möglichkeit gibt, eine Funktion zu implementieren, die sich ähnlich wie Map Getter verhält: Sie gibt den Rückgabewert als erstes Argument und den (optional zugewiesenen) zweiten Wert zurückok als zweites Argument. Also ...
Was sind Konventionen für Dateinamen in Go?
Ich konnte die Konventionen für die Benennung von Paketen in Go finden: kein Unterstrich zwischen Wörtern, alles in Kleinbuchstaben. Gilt diese Konvention auch für die Dateinamen? Fügen Sie auch eine Struktur in eine Datei ein, als ob Sie dies ...
Schutz vor Golang-Panik
In Golang wird der Prozess durch eine Panik ohne Wiederherstellung zum Absturz gebracht, sodass ich den folgenden Code-Snippet am Anfang jeder Funktion platziere: defer func() { if err := recover(); err != nil { fmt.Println(err) } }()Nur um ...
Wie versende ich E-Mails über die Google Mail-API? Gehen
Ich versuche eine E-Mail über das zu sendenGoogle Mail-API [https://developers.google.com/gmail/api/v1/reference/users/messages/send]mit Gehen [http://golang.org]aber ich finde die dokumentation ziemlich fehlerhaft / verwirrend. Ausnahmsweise ...
Wie man Zeitzonencodes richtig parst
Im folgenden Beispiel ist das Ergebnis immer "[Datum] 05:00:00 +0000 UTC", unabhängig von der Zeitzone, die Sie für die Funktion parseAndPrint ausgewählt haben. Was ist los mit diesem Code? Die Zeit sollte sich je nach gewählter Zeitzone ändern. ...
“Ungültiges Zeichen '\ x00' nach dem Wert der obersten Ebene”
Ich erhalte diesen Fehler, während ich json in einer for-Schleife dekomprimiere. Das erste Mal durch die Schleife ist unmarshalling in Ordnung, aber bei der nächsten Iteration erhalte ich diesen Fehler. Ich bin neu in Golang und diese ...
Golang - Kopieren Sie die Exec-Ausgabe in das Protokoll
Ich möchte die Ausgabe eines Prozesses an umleitenlog rechtzeitig. Ich kann es tun, wenn ich darauf warte, dass der Vorgang wie folgt abgeschlossen wird: cmd := exec.Command("yes", "Go is awesome") // Prints "Go is awesome", forever out, err := ...
So senden Sie E-Mails über das Gmail Go SDK
Ich versuche eine neue E-Mail über das zu sendenGoogle Mail [http://godoc.org/code.google.com/p/google-api-go-client/gmail/v1]paket. Die Botschaft [http://godoc.org/code.google.com/p/google-api-go-client/gmail/v1#Message]Typ, der von der ...
Warum golang reflect.MakeSlice einen nicht adressierbaren Wert zurückgibt
Überprüfen Sie das folgende Snippet: http://play.golang.org/p/xusdITxgT- [http://play.golang.org/p/xusdITxgT-] Warum passiert dies? Denn eines meiner Argumente muss eine Slice-Adresse sein. Vielleicht habe ich es nicht allen ...